The ship with aid for Gaza was attacked by a drone just outside Maltese territorial waters, the international non-governmental organization Freedom Flotilla Coalition said in a message on X. The attack caused damage to the hull and a fire.

Malta’s local media reported that all persons on the vessel were rescued, and there were no injuries. Local media also reported that an Israeli military aircraft hovered around Malta hours before the vessel was attacked.

In an earlier statement, the government confirmed that a distress call was received and that the authorities offered immediate assistance. An Armed Forces of Malta patrol boat was also dispatched to the area.

In a joint statement, the Shin Bet and the Israel Defense Forces (IDF) said the strike targeted a “command and control centre” used by Hamas and Islamic Jihad militants that was embedded within the Yaffa School in the Tuffah neighbourhood of Gaza City.

According to the statement, militants used the site to “plan and execute terrorist attacks against Israeli civilians and IDF troops.”

Israel has faced repeated accusations of striking schools, tent camps, medical facilities, and UN shelters housing displaced people. Israel often argues it targets militants hiding within civilian infrastructure.

At least 51,305 people have been killed in Israeli strikes on Gaza since the offensive began in October 2023, according to an update from Gaza’s health authorities.

GAZA, April 7, 2025 (WAFA) — At least 10 civilians, including journalists, were killed and others injured early Monday morning in Israeli airstrikes on various areas of the Gaza Strip.

Local sources reported that Israeli warplanes bombed a journalists’ tent near Nasser Medical Complex Hospital in Khan Yunis, killing journalist Hilmi al-Faqawi and Yousef al-Khazindar. Journalists Ahmed Mansour, Hassan Islayh, Ahmed al-Agha, Mohammed Fayeq, Abdullah al-Attar, Ihab al-Bardini, Mahmoud Awad, Majed Qudaih, and Ali Islayh were injured, some seriously.

The sources added that the Israeli occupation bombed two houses west of Deir al-Balah in the central Gaza Strip, killing two citizens and wounding others.

WAFA correspondent said that Israeli drones targeted a group of citizens on Wadi al-Arayes Street in the al-Zeitoun neighborhood south of Gaza City, killing three citizens: Ghassan Bassam al-Anqar, Awad Jamal al-Harazin, and Saeed Ashour Daghmash.

He added that the occupation also bombed Masoud Street in the Al-Jurn area north of Gaza City, killing Abdul Karim Akram Muqbil. Two citizens were also killed and others wounded in the occupation’s bombing of Jabalia al-Balad, north of the Gaza Strip.
